Nominations Are Now Being Accepted for the Annual Community Service Award

Last Updated 2/2/2026

This prestigious award was initiated in 1950 to recognize an individual within the community who has given services above and beyond their paid employment.  Osceola Chamber - Main Street and Osceola Rotary Club co-sponsor the award.

Do you know someone who has made a significant contribution to our community through their time, actions, talents and dedication? The honoree nominated should serve as a role model for striving to make our community a better place.

The award will be presented at the Greater Osceola Partnership Annual Celebration on March 6.

The selection of the award winner will be determined by a committee comprised of OCMS Board Members, Rotary Members and past community service award recipients.

Nomination Requirements:

1. Nomination Letter (from Nominator(s)): The nomination letter needs to describe the community service and the significance and impact it has had in the community.

2. All nominations must be signed. They can be mailed, dropped off at the Osceola Chamber - Main Street office or emailed to [email protected]

3. Nominations must be received by February 16.
